As a senior in 2025: Played and started in all 53 games hitting .333 with a .916 OPS across 225 at-bats ... slashed 75 total hits with 13 doubles, nine home runs and 46 RBI ... scored 48 runs and was 3-3 on stealing bases ... had 23 multi-hit efforts including five games with 3+ hits ... began the season with a 4-5 effort against Henderson State on January 31 where he hit three home runs and drove in seven RBI, each tying program single-game records ... threw out a team-high 11 base-stealers while making 342 putouts behind the plate with 10 assists ... named to the All-MIAA second team at catcher
As a junior in 2024: Played in 51 games making 50 starts with 68 hits, nine home runs and 57 RBI while hitting .352 with a .977 OPS ... tied for the team high with three triples, also went 6-7 on stolen base attempts ... had 3+ hits in seven games ... went 4-4 with a home run, three runs scored and three RBI on Feb. 27 against Rockhurst ... had four RBI in two games ... threw out a team-high 10 runners from behind the plate ... earned All-MIAA second team honors at catcher ... named to the MIAA Academic Honor Roll
Background: Played two seasons at Northern Oklahoma College – Tonkawa ... helped the Mavericks to a 24-4 season as a freshman ... starting every game before the season ended due to COVID ... transferred to Northwestern Oklahoma State for two seasons ... was an All-GAC honorable mention at catcher as a freshman ... four-year member of the Enid HS baseball team ... helped the Plainsmen to a 27-6 record with a district championship as a junior ... also played three seasons of football
